Here's a hint for attempting to find a good recent game on steam.

Don't go to popular new releases or top sellers. Instead go to ALL new releases and look at the games. But first go to the little side bar on the right and click games to filter out DLC, OSTs and demos(you still can't filter VR games so just ignore any game with the that one VR logo on it because they all look like gimmicky dogshit). If reviews are positive and the title/cover art looks half decent look at it and see if it seems good to you or not. As a rule I try and only look for the games priced 10$ and above but I recall seeing TEC 3001 which is priced for 4 dollars and I really enjoyed that.

Back in the day, it used to be that major studios wouldn't have every single game be either a ruinously expensive blockbuster or cheap cash-in; they'd make mid-budget games as well, usually in more experimental or niche genres and franchses which can make a profit easier, aren't too big a loss if they flop and keep the programmers busy.

But nowadays between inflated profit expectations, routinely treating staff like shit and ruinous graphics budgets, middleware has died out and very few companies even remember how not to break the budget with every game.
